Output 50bdfe628bba3427b31e78aa0b2e26c8615f530a8534bfc4f436d71e447f547f:1

value
1497071338
script pubkey
OP_0 OP_PUSHBYTES_20 3068d890b9ae116940e8a984b717a3edd858a700
address
bc1qxp5d3y9e4cgkjs8g4xztw9arahv93fcqlse4pq
transaction
50bdfe628bba3427b31e78aa0b2e26c8615f530a8534bfc4f436d71e447f547f
spent
true